Tan Jee Ming
Tan Jee Ming was called to the Singapore Bar in 1986 after graduating from the Faculty of Law, NUS a year earlier. He commenced practice immediately after that mainly in the field of litigation. As an advocate and solicitor, he undertook a wide range of both civil and criminal litigation. His work has brought him through almost every rung of the Singapore Judiciary.
In 1996, he started his own legal practice, Tan Jee Ming & Partners, a boutique practice which catered to a wide range of legal needs both domestic and cross-border.
After a professional span of 14 years, Tan Jee Ming & Partners merged with Straits Law Practice LLC in 2010. As a result of the merger, the legal works scope which is now undertaken by Tan Jee Ming has become even more diversed.
Currently, Tan Jee Ming sits on the Review Committee and Inquiry Committee of the Law Society of Singapore. He is also appointed by the Honourable Chief Justice as a member of the Disciplinary Tribunal.
